About this day nursery

Country Mice Nursery, situated in Horsham, operates Monday to Friday, aligning with the academic school calendar, and caters to children from 2 to 11 years old. The nursery emphasises a learning environment fostered through play and exploration, encouraging children to develop into well-rounded, caring, resilient, respectful, and resourceful individuals.

They offer a variety of sessions, including morning, afternoon, and full-day nursery care, alongside before and after-school clubs. Children are provided with opportunities for both indoor and outdoor activities, sensory play, phonics, puzzles, and more, with a rolling snack time during morning sessions and a social lunch experience in the afternoons.

The nursery also works in partnership with St Peter’s Primary School to offer breakfast sessions. They are committed to providing flexible childcare options for registered families and proudly highlight their professional and caring team of practitioners.

The nursery actively welcomes government funding initiatives to support families with childcare costs.

What it's like to attend

Children receive a very warm welcome and feel valued. The effective key-person system helps new children settle, supporting their emotional well-being. Children demonstrate independence and confidence, making choices from play resources and showing positive attitudes to learning, alongside good manners and behaviours.

Inspector highlights

  • Managers are inspiring leaders and positive role models to practitioners and apprentices, with a clear vision for children's learning.
  • Parents speak highly of the nursery, praising the support their children receive and feeling involved in their learning.
  • There is a strong focus on developing children's literacy skills, with opportunities for writing for a purpose.
  • Support for children with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ND) and their families is a particular strength.
  • There is a strong emphasis on promoting inclusive practice, with visits to a farm and allotments.

Areas to develop

  • 1support practitioners to make even better use of their interactions with children to extend their thinking and develop their communication and language skills even further
  • 2review the organisation of some activities to ensure children can participate fully and gain the intended knowledge and skills.

Inclusion & environment

How they support every child

SEND provision

Support for children with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ND) and their families is a particular strength of the nursery. Practitioners quickly identify where children may need additional support and seek prompt help from a range of professionals. They follow targeted plans and provide speech and language focus sessions.

Outdoor space

Children have good opportunities to play outside. They relish opportunities to explore the outdoor kitchen, paint at the easel and ride their bikes around the roadway, which develops their physical skills.
